Ben Stein is the most famous economics teacher in America. His comedic role as the droning economics teacher in "Ferris Bueller`s Day Off" is by far the most widely viewed scene of economics teaching in economics history and has been ranked as one of the fifty most famous scenes in movie history. He has written about finance for Barron's, the Wall Street Journal, the New York Times, and Fortune; was one of the chief busters of the junk-bond frauds of the 1980s; has been a longtime critic of corporate executives' self-dealing; and has cowritten eight finance books. In it, Stein …Dec 20, 2018 · Ben Stein would add, invest your savings wisely in a stock market index fund such as S&P 500 Index Fund (SPY). He said that is the best and simplest way to become a capitalist. Become a part owner in the 500 largest publicly traded companies in America, and hold for the long term, through thick and thin (trying to time the market is usually a ... However, he encourages people to start small and save something. Bach likens retirement saving to preparing for a marathon. You don’t go run 26 miles on your first training day. You don’t sit home on the couch either. If you should be saving $2,000 a month, just start by saving $2 a day. Book details & editions.Ben Stein's "Perfect" Portfolio? by White Coat Investor » Thu Jun 14, 2007 5:28 pm. Taken from an article on CNN-Money, I thought this was particularly disappointing, particularly the recommendation to put 25% in a 500 Fund AND 25% in TSM. It isn't that it is a bad allocation, simply that it is overly complex to hold both funds.
